    Bird Streets Club Is Adding a Restaurant

    By Sara Rosenthal,

    2024-05-31

    Bird Streets Club on the Sunset Strip is converting its enclosed parking lot into restaurant space, reports the WeHo Times .

    The members-only club known to host the likes of A-listers like Justin and Hailey Bieber, Rihanna, Taylor Swift, Travis Kelce, among others, is operated by The h.wood Group. The lifestyle and hospitality firm also operates several other popular establishments like Bootsy Bellows, The Nice Guy, Delilah, and more. Beyond its brick-and-mortar concepts, h.wood also works with some of the most reputable event producers in the world.

    “The h.wood Group’s signature approach to service and storytelling unites brands, consumers and talent at some of the world’s most iconic cultural events including Coachella, F1, Cannes, Art Basel and more. The h.wood Group offers corporate branding, catering, event production and marketing services at both private events and international pop-ups, reflecting and shaping popular culture on both local and global scales,” says their website .

    The group was founded by longtime friends John Terzian and Brian Toll in 2008 to help entrepreneurs bring high-end concepts with upscale service to life. Today, they operate 15 concepts worldwide.

    Not much else is known about Bird Streets Club’s new restaurant at this time. Stay tuned for updates as this story progresses.
